Analysis

Puerto Rico recorded 17.09 headcount basis for pupil-qualified teacher ratio in secondary in 2024.

That represents a change of down 0.9% over ten years.

Over the whole period, pupil-qualified teacher ratio in secondary in Puerto Rico peaked at 18.91 headcount basis in 2015 and was at its lowest, 12.89 headcount basis, in 2013.

Puerto Rico ranks 37th of 86 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

Pupil-qualified teacher ratio in secondary in Puerto Rico, year by year

Annual values for Pupil-qualified teacher ratio in secondary (headcount basis) in Puerto Rico, 2013 to 2024.
Year headcount basis Change
2013 12.89 headcount basis
2014 17.24 headcount basis +33.7%
2015 18.91 headcount basis +9.7%
2016 17.16 headcount basis -9.3%
2024 17.09 headcount basis -0.4%
